There were talks of the link above being dead, which it is,
mr Mac talked with van and this was the reply:
I just ordered a charging handle from MECH ARMOUR after getting this e-mail: this is for our forum members, and is a really good price if you use this special link!
Hey Mack,
I just looked because I knew no one took down the 308AR charging handle deal page, and it is still there. So you can go to this hidden link to purchase what you need. Do us a favor and spread this link around on 308 in case others think the sales pages were removed.
http://mechdefense.com/products/308ar-com-group-buy-sale